Job description

mselect is looking to hire a Budget Controller for a oil and gas operator in Doha, Qatar. Candidates must have at least 7 years of relevant experience in project cost budget control, experience in the Oil & Gas industry is preferable. Fluency in English is a must.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are Work Program and Budget pack for Annual Budgets (CAPEX/OPEX/NON-ROUTINE) and ensure it is accurately mapped in SAP
  • Prepare Budget Revisions/Supplementary Budget and ensure appropriate justification and supporting documentation is valid and enough
  • Prepare AFEs with accuracy and ensure the requested AFE is following Policy and Procedures
  • Ensure compliance with and implementation of approved Budget Control Procedures and Work Instructions
  • Review reallocation journal/expenditure postings in SAP FI and advise proper allocation of AFE number and WBS Element
  • Work in close coordination with the cost, planning & project team to ensure proper and timely recording of expenditure through Service Entry Sheets
  • Provide solutions to the project team on budget issues and ensure invoices are processed and returned to Finance for payment within target dates
  • Justify monthly and quarterly variance and ensure the reasons are valid and obtain mitigation measures from cost, planning & project team
  • Review the project status, CWIP and Completion Certificates to ensure the capitalization process is in line with Policy and Procedures
  • Participate in continuous improvement of budget control activities
  • Capacity to prepare ad-hoc reports for specific budget and cost analyses when required
  • Provide on-the-job coaching & development of staff

Requirements

  • A university/college degree in financial accounting or CPA, ACCA CGMA or equivalent
  • At least 7 years of relevant experience in project cost budget control
  • Experience in the Oil & Gas industry is preferable
  • Effective anal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to detail Ability to adapt to changing priorities and manage multiple tasks simultaneously
  • Performs routine duties independently and refers to Line Supervisors on non-routine work
  • Working knowledge in SAP (e.g. PS, MM modules) is essential
  • Good knowledge of MS Office applications and Database particularly in Excel and PowerPoint
